Job Description

Senior Business Process Analyst

General Dynamics

• Help ensure today is safe and tomorrow is smarter • Contributes to project success by influencing individuals on and outside of your team • Collects information by engaging in dialogue with staff, reviewing databases, and interpreting reports • Produces reporting on an as-needed basis (daily, weekly, monthly) • Determines business metrics to meet ongoing organizational or client informational needs • Provides data analytics and key insights • Collects detailed project requirements; collaborates with developers to create future state automated workflows • Highlights and defines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to measure performance across different sections

Job Requirements

  • 3+ years of related experience
  • Technical Training, Certification(s) or Degree
  • Experience with dashboards and reporting in Microsoft Power BI and Tableau
  • Experience with Microsoft Power Platform and Microsoft Office
  • Experience creating detailed, keystroke-level documentation for end users
  • Experience with Agile methodology and practices
  • Initiative to develop, run, and present project reports
  • Ability to effectively manage multiple competing priorities
  • Good team player with the ability to adapt to changing client needs
  • Outstanding communication skills with the ability to present to business leaders
  • Demonstrated experience consulting with internal and external customers to understand business needs and make recommendations
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with attention to detail and accuracy
  • Able to work independently and as part of a team
  • Must possess or be able to obtain a Secret clearance
  • US Citizenship Required

Role Description As an Experienced Provider+ Business Analyst - MMIS / Medicaid Pharmacy at Gainwell, you can contribute your skills as we harness the power of technology to help our clients improve the health and well-being of the members they serve — a community’s most vulnerable. Connect your passion with purpose, teaming with people who thrive on finding innovative solutions to some of healthcare’s biggest challenges. The Experienced Provider+ Business Analyst supports business, policy, and technical execution across one or more functional domains within MMIS Medicaid Management Information Systems (MMIS) and/or the Medicaid Pharmacy environment. Supported domains may include: - Member - Provider - Claims (Medicaid, Dental and/or Pharmacy) - Finance - Plan and Care Management - Business Relationship Management This role supports end‑to‑end domain delivery by translating state and federal Medicaid policy and program requirements into product features, system configuration, and design artifacts. The Business Analyst works closely with the Domain Lead, Technical Analysts, and cross‑functional teams and acts as a domain and policy subject-matter expert (SME) to ensure successful implementation and operational readiness. Qualifications -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, Health Informatics, or a related field. - 5 to 8 years of hands-on experience supporting healthcare system implementations, including MMIS solutions and Medicaid Pharmacy platforms. - Experience with QNXT or similar healthcare claims/encounter management systems. - Strong knowledge of state and federal Medicaid policy, regulations, and program rules. - Strong understanding of Medicaid domains, including claims, member, provider, and prior authorization processes. - Demonstrated experience translating policy and program rules into system requirements, configuration support, and design artifacts. - Strong knowledge of SQL, particularly for data analysis and validation. - Strong client communication skills, with experience interacting directly with business stakeholders. - Proven ability to lead or support functional demonstrations, walkthroughs, and collaborative working sessions. - Strong documentation, facilitation, and analytical skills. - Experience working in SDLC and Agile delivery environments. Requirements - Acts as the primary Domain SME, serving as a trusted advisor to the Engagement Lead (EL) on business processes and associated regulatory and operational impacts. - Ensures compliance alignment by validating that solution design and configuration conform to CMS guidance, state policy, and documented business rules. - Supports the EL with in-scope negotiations and change control, providing domain expertise to assess scope trade-offs and the functional, regulatory, and operational impacts of change requests. - Lead and participate in collaborative requirements and design sessions with clients and internal teams to validate functional and technical needs. - Interpret state and federal Medicaid policy, regulations, and program rules and translate them into product features, system configuration, business rules, and design artifacts. - Develop and maintain domain design documentation, with the Design Document as a core deliverable, covering workflows, interfaces, X12 EDI transactions, letters, and reports. - Ensure accuracy, completeness, and traceability of requirements and acceptance criteria. - Document and communicate domain-level decisions, risks, assumptions, and dependencies, assessing downstream impacts. - Support domain-specific configuration and implementation activities within Design, Development, and Implementation (DDI) projects. - Responsible for configuration and partner with technical teams to ensure solutions align with approved design documentation, Medicaid policy interpretation, and documented business rules. - Review test cases to ensure alignment with requirements, policy interpretation, and acceptance criteria. - Provide domain SME support during System Integration Testing (SIT) and User Acceptance Testing (UAT). - Support operational readiness activities, including environment, data, process, and staffing readiness. - Work closely with the Domain Lead and Technical Analysts, acting as a trusted domain and policy SME. - Lead and support client communication, including requirement discussions, design reviews, and issue resolution.
